🌴 2. Bali, Indonesia – The Digital Nomad Paradise

With affordable living, tropical beaches, and a massive expat community, Bali is the dream hub for remote workers. Coworking cafés in Canggu and Ubud are legendary.

🌊 4. Lisbon, Portugal – Europe’s Remote Work Darling

Lisbon is trending big time among digital nomads thanks to its affordability, strong Wi-Fi, and sunny climate. Beach after work? Yes, please.
